How Probation Office in Lincoln Park: What to Expect During Meetings Actually Works

When someone needs to visit the probation office in Lincoln Park, the process usually begins with a scheduled appointment or a court-ordered check-in. Upon arrival, the individual will typically check in at the front desk and provide identification and any required court documents. The waiting area is generally structured and quiet, reflecting the official nature of the environment. Staff members are usually professional and focused on maintaining order and security for everyone present.

The meeting itself is often conducted in a small office or interview room. A probation officer will review the individual’s case, discussing the conditions of their probation, such as reporting frequency, employment status, and compliance with any court mandates. For example, the officer might ask about recent employment or verify that the individual has attended required counseling sessions. These questions are not meant to be intrusive but are designed to ensure public safety and the successful reintegration of the individual into the community.

Technologies such as electronic monitoring or drug testing might also be part of the conversation. The officer will explain any changes to the terms of probation clearly, leaving no room for confusion. Common Questions People Have About Probation Office in Lincoln Park: What to Expect During Meetings

Individuals often wonder how early they should arrive for an appointment at the probation office in Lincoln Park. Arriving about fifteen minutes early is generally recommended to complete any necessary paperwork and to account for security checks. This buffer time helps reduce anxiety and ensures the meeting starts promptly. Being punctual demonstrates respect for the officer's time and a commitment to the process.

Another frequent question concerns the nature of the conversation. People worry that the meeting will be confrontational or accusatory. In reality, the tone is typically professional and business-like. The officer’s primary focus is to gather information and verify compliance. Treating the interaction as a routine business appointment can help manage expectations and foster a cooperative attitude.

A third common question relates to documentation. It is essential to bring all required documents, such as identification, proof of employment, or letters from counselors. Forgetting these items can lead to delays or the need for a second visit. Preparing a simple checklist beforehand ensures that the meeting at the probation office in Lincoln Park is efficient and productive, leaving a positive impression.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One major misunderstanding is that probation meetings are punitive by nature. While there are consequences for violations, the primary function is supervision and support. The probation office in Lincoln Park aims to guide individuals toward positive behavior and long-term stability. Shifting this perspective from punishment to guidance can change the entire experience.

Another myth is that probation officers do not have the individual’s best interests at heart. In truth, officers often connect clients with resources such as job training, substance abuse programs, and mental health services. The goal is to address the root causes of legal issues. Seeing the officer as a connector to vital services can transform the dynamic of the relationship.

Some people also believe that a single mistake will lead to immediate revocation of probation. While violations are taken seriously, officers typically follow a graduated response system. A first-time minor infraction might result in a warning or additional meetings. This structure allows for learning and correction, reinforcing the idea that the system allows for growth and change.
